Where To Birth

 HOMEBIRTH:

 ADVANTAGES OF HOME BIRTH...

  • Statistics show homebirth safety for low risk women with adequate prenatal care, and a qualified birth attendant.
  • Labor can progress naturally, without unnecessary interventions.
  • Women can eat, drink, walk, make noises, shower, bathe, etc. 
  • Cost of home birth is less than hospital.
  • Continuous care given by a midwife throughout labor, birth and postpartum.
  • Women are encouraged and supported while they maintain control of their birth experience.
  • Care-givers establish a trusting relationship with the birthing family. 
  • Mother/baby bonding is enhanced and breastfeeding is supported.

 

 
 DISADVANTAGES OF HOMEBIRTH...
  • Client must assume a greater responsibility for their own health.
  • Negative judgments and lack of support from people that view hospital birth as socially correct.
  • Cesareans, forceps and anesthetics are not readily available requiring transport if necessary.
  • 24 hour maternity nursing care is usually unavailable. 
 
BIRTH CENTER:

  ADVANTAGES OF A   BIRTH CENTER...

  • Facility is only provided for pregnancy and birth events. 
  • Offers more personalized care than most hospitals.
  • Pregnancy is considered a natural and healthy process in a birth center.
  • During pregnancy, women are encouraged to take charge of their own health.
  • Greater parental control, freedom to move and eat, and the choice of birthing positions.
  • Lower cesarean and forcep rates than hospitals. 
  • Women are allowed to return home within hours.

 DISADVANTAGES OF A BIRTH CENTER...
 
  • Screening process eliminates many healthy mothers, i.e., VBAC; mothers over 35, etc.
  • Mother must travel to center and labor away from home environment.
  • Many centers have protocols requiring transport to hospital for prolonged labor, etc.
  • Many communities do not have birth centers.
 
 
HOSPITAL BIRTH:
 
 ADVANTAGES OF HOSPITAL BIRTH...
 
  • Some mothers feel safest laboring in a hospital. 
  • Emergency cesarean is readily available in hospital.
  • In some cases it is the safest environment for the high risk mother or baby.
  • Immediate pediatric care for newborn needing medical care. 
  • 24 hour maternity nursing care is available.

 DISADVANTAGES OF HOSPITAL BIRTH...
  • Parents do not have control of their birth. 
  • Less privacy and increase of fear in some women.
  • The father is less likely to be actively involved during labor and birth.
  • Routine separation of the mother and baby is almost unavoidable.
  • Birth is managed by people trained in pathology, not normal birth.
  • Risk of having an unnecessary cesarean or episiotomy is higher.
  • Risk of infection or iatrogenic complications to mother and baby is increased.
  • Proper nourishment during labor and adequate rest is limited due to hospital protocols.
